Description
Removing biases from climate models' output so far has been considered to be a part of downscaling processes. However, from application's perspective, it is the biases rather than spatial resolution gap that one has to maneuver when applying climate model's forcings. There has been several bias correction techniques emerged, yet there is very limited studies showing how these techniques are different and how the difference itself would affect the application results. In this study, we apply popular bias correction methods to regional climate model's daily precipitation over Japan, and show their differences by comparing occurrence intervals of a heavy rainfall event.
